Nursing today extends far beyond bedside care. With the rapid evolution of healthcare technology, patient care models, and public health systems, nurses can now choose from a wide range of dynamic, high-impact careers in education, management, technology, research, policy, and entrepreneurship.
1οΈβ£ Nursing Informatics Specialist
Role: Combines nursing science and data technology to improve clinical efficiency.
Where: Hospitals, EMR companies, health IT firms.
Why it matters: Enhances patient safety and streamlines workflow through data management.
2οΈβ£ Clinic Nurse
Role: Provides outpatient care, immunizations, and patient education in non-hospital settings.
Where: Clinics, ambulatory centers, GP offices.
Why it matters: Offers consistent patient follow-up and preventive care.
3οΈβ£ Case Manager (Utilization Review/Discharge Planning)
Role: Coordinates patient care from admission to discharge, ensuring smooth transitions.
Where: Hospitals, insurance providers.
Why it matters: Reduces readmissions and improves resource efficiency.
4οΈβ£ Nurse Educator
Role: Trains and mentors nursing students or hospital staff.
Where: Nursing colleges, universities, hospitals.
Why it matters: Shapes future nurses and promotes lifelong learning.
5οΈβ£ Quality Management Nurse
Role: Ensures hospitals maintain high standards of safety, compliance, and accreditation.
Where: Healthcare institutions, accreditation boards.
Why it matters: Improves patient outcomes and regulatory performance.
6οΈβ£ Certified Diabetes Educator
Role: Educates and counsels patients on diabetes management, insulin use, and nutrition.
Where: Endocrine clinics, community health programs.
Why it matters: Helps reduce complications and improve patient independence.
7οΈβ£ Preadmission Testing Nurse
Role: Evaluates surgical candidates through health checks and testing.
Where: Surgical and day-care centers.
Why it matters: Minimizes risks and improves surgical outcomes.
8οΈβ£ Hospice Nurse
Role: Provides comfort-focused care for terminally ill patients.
Where: Hospices, palliative home care.
Why it matters: Promotes dignity and quality of life at end-of-life stages.
9οΈβ£ Home Health Nurse
Role: Delivers nursing services to patients at home.
Where: Home care agencies, private practice.
Why it matters: Enables personalized care and rehabilitation at home.
π Infusion Nurse (Ambulatory Care)
Role: Administers IV medications, chemotherapy, and fluids safely.
Where: Outpatient clinics, oncology units.
Why it matters: Provides vital therapy outside hospital admission.
11οΈβ£ Nurse Recruiter (HR)
Role: Manages hiring and onboarding of nursing staff.
Where: Hospitals, HR firms, agencies.
Why it matters: Ensures qualified professionals join healthcare systems.
12οΈβ£ Wound Care Nurse
Role: Specializes in assessing and treating complex wounds and ulcers.
Where: Hospitals, rehab centers, long-term care.
Why it matters: Prevents infections and accelerates healing.
13οΈβ£ Telehealth Nurse
Role: Offers nursing care and consultations remotely using digital platforms.
Where: Telemedicine companies, hospitals.
Why it matters: Expands healthcare access globally.
14οΈβ£ Telephone Advice Nurse
Role: Provides medical guidance over the phone to triage patients.
Where: Hospital call centers, insurance helplines.
Why it matters: Reduces unnecessary ER visits and supports patient safety.
15οΈβ£ Transplant Nurse
Role: Coordinates organ transplant processes, manages donor-recipient care.
Where: Organ transplant units, specialized hospitals.
Why it matters: Saves lives through complex multidisciplinary teamwork.
16οΈβ£ Public Health Nurse
Role: Works in community health promotion, disease prevention, and vaccination drives.
Where: Health departments, NGOs, schools.
Why it matters: Strengthens population health and preventive care.
17οΈβ£ Occupational Health Nurse
Role: Manages employee health, safety, and wellness in workplaces.
Where: Corporations, factories, industrial sectors.
Why it matters: Reduces workplace injuries and promotes wellness culture.
18οΈβ£ Legal Nurse Consultant
Role: Reviews medical records and provides expert opinions in legal cases.
Where: Law firms, insurance companies.
Why it matters: Connects healthcare and legal justice for fair case evaluation.
19οΈβ£ Research Nurse
Role: Assists in clinical trials, collects data, and ensures ethical compliance.
Where: Research institutes, pharma companies.
Why it matters: Contributes to medical advancement and evidence-based care.
20οΈβ£ Infection Control Nurse
Role: Implements infection prevention strategies and conducts surveillance.
Where: Hospitals, public health agencies.
Why it matters: Protects both patients and staff from infectious risks.
21οΈβ£ Nurse Health Coach
Role: Guides clients in lifestyle modification, diet, and chronic disease prevention.
Where: Wellness centers, online platforms.
Why it matters: Empowers patients toward sustainable healthy living.
22οΈβ£ Forensic Nurse
Role: Provides care to victims of assault and collects medical-legal evidence.
Where: Emergency units, forensic departments, law enforcement agencies.
Why it matters: Supports justice and compassionate care for victims.
23οΈβ£ Flight Nurse
Role: Provides critical care during air ambulance transport.
Where: Emergency transport services, disaster relief.
Why it matters: Saves lives in transit through advanced critical care.
24οΈβ£ Clinical Research Associate (CRA)
Role: Monitors clinical studies and ensures protocol compliance.
Where: Pharmaceutical and biotech firms.
Why it matters: Ensures scientific accuracy and ethical practice in clinical trials.
25οΈβ£ Nurse Entrepreneur
Role: Builds independent ventures such as clinics, training centers, or wellness programs.
Where: Self-employed or through startups.
Why it matters: Combines nursing expertise with leadership and innovation.
